A new shop in an old building.

Louise's is named for Lou's grandmother, Louise Lankford — one of the sassiest, classiest ladies she ever knew. The shop means to live up to her.

How a schoolteacher of 38 years came out of retirement to take over one of the Shore's last dress shops — in an old bank, with a 1938 Vogue and a Dior hat full of candy — well, that's a longer story.
